My Son’s Pregnant Girlfriend Hated Me for Requesting a DNA Test—But Her Mom’s Secret Changed Everything

My son Ryan, during his senior year of college, learned that his girlfriend of just three weeks was pregnant. I advised him to get a DNA test. He went ahead with it, and since it revealed he was the father, he opted to marry her.

Shelley was furious about the DNA test request. She spread rumors about me, leading to my exclusion from the wedding… Everyone turned against me.

Two weeks before the big day, Shelley’s mom made an unexpected call.

HER: “Get in the car and drive over. IT’S URGENT!”

ME: “Hey Jen, what’s going on?”

She made a startling revelation…

HER: “We need to CANCEL THE WEDDING. ASAP!”

I remember pulling the phone away from my ear, staring at it like it might offer more explanation. “Cancel the wedding?” I repeated, my voice flat with disbelief. “Why now?”

Jen’s voice trembled. “Just come over. Please. I can’t say it over the phone.”

I didn’t hesitate. I grabbed my keys and coat and drove across town, my mind racing with all the possible disasters that could’ve triggered that call. Maybe Shelley was cheating? Maybe it wasn’t Ryan’s baby after all?

When I got to Jen’s house, she was pacing in the driveway with a cigarette in hand, even though she’d supposedly quit five years ago. Her hands were shaking.

She led me inside, sat me down, and poured me a glass of water before she even spoke.

“You were right,” she said finally, her eyes brimming with guilt. “You were right to ask for a DNA test. Shelley’s been lying to everyone, and I can’t be part of it anymore.”

My stomach turned. “Lying about what?”

She hesitated. “The pregnancy. She told me the timing didn’t add up weeks ago. But she said she was sure it was Ryan’s. She wanted to believe that.”

Jen paused, rubbing her temples like she was trying to make the words come out right.

“But now I’ve seen the texts from her ex. They never actually broke up before she started seeing Ryan. There was overlap. And her ex wants to be part of the baby’s life. He even asked if she’s sure Ryan is the father.”

I couldn’t even speak. My throat dried up.

“Wait,” I finally croaked. “But Ryan got a paternity test. It said he’s the dad.”

Jen nodded slowly. “I asked to see it. Shelley showed me a printed report, not even the original email or login. And I noticed something. The name on the document? It said Rayen, not Ryan. Shelley forged it. I confronted her and… she admitted everything.”

I sat there in silence. It all made sense now—her outrage, the rumors, the way she turned Ryan against me. It was all to cover up this massive lie.

“But why?” I asked. “Why go so far?”

“She thought Ryan was safer. Her ex is a mess—unstable job, drinks too much, still lives with his parents. Ryan was her ticket to stability.”

I couldn’t believe what I was hearing. And my heart broke for my son, who genuinely believed he was building a family.

“She’s crying upstairs,” Jen added quietly. “She wants to confess to Ryan before the wedding. But she’s scared. She’s still holding onto the idea he might forgive her.”

I drove home that night in silence. I didn’t sleep. I kept picturing Ryan’s face when he’d find out everything. And I kept replaying the moment he told me to stay out of his life, that I was “poisoning his relationship.”

But I also remembered who he was before Shelley—kind, focused, a bit naive, sure, but with a good heart.

The next day, Jen called again. “She won’t do it. She’s going through with the wedding unless someone stops her.”

I knew then that it had to be me.

I showed up at Ryan’s apartment. He opened the door looking surprised and a little annoyed.

“Thought you weren’t coming to the wedding,” he said, arms crossed.

“I wasn’t. But we need to talk.”

He rolled his eyes. “More accusations?”

I looked him straight in the eye. “Shelley forged the paternity test, Ryan.”

That stopped him. His expression shifted. “What?”

“She’s not even sure if the baby is yours. Her ex is back in the picture, and there’s a good chance—”

“You need to stop,” he cut in sharply. “You’ll say anything to break us up.”

“No,” I said, softer this time. “I just want the truth. You’re about to marry someone who lied to your face. Who let you believe you were the father of a baby that may not even be yours.”

He looked shaken, but still clinging to his anger. “You have proof?”

“Go ask her to show you the paternity email. Not the paper copy she printed. The actual email from the lab.”

Ryan didn’t say another word. He closed the door and I stood there, heart pounding.

I didn’t hear from him for three days.

Then, at 6:42 AM on the morning of the wedding, my phone rang.

It was Ryan.

“She admitted it,” he said quietly. “It’s not mine.”

His voice cracked.

I held my breath.

“I’m calling off the wedding.”

The ceremony was scheduled for noon. People were flying in, hotels were booked. But Ryan made the announcement himself, stood in front of all their friends and explained. He didn’t drag Shelley through the mud, just said “circumstances changed” and that they’d “both made mistakes.”

He moved back in with me that weekend. We didn’t talk much about it at first. He mostly stayed in his room, numb.

But a few weeks later, he came out to the porch one night and sat beside me.

“You were just trying to protect me,” he said.

I nodded. “Always will.”

He let out a heavy sigh. “I feel like such an idiot.”

“You’re not,” I told him. “You just loved someone who didn’t deserve it.”

He didn’t reply, but I saw something soften in his eyes.

A few months later, Shelley had the baby. And the ex—her old boyfriend—filed for paternity rights. A new DNA test confirmed he was the father.

Ryan watched it all unfold from a distance. He never reached out, never got involved.

He started going back to the gym, picked up a part-time job while looking for full-time positions. Eventually, he met someone else—a woman named Lira, who worked at a small nonprofit downtown. She was quiet, thoughtful, nothing like Shelley.

They dated for almost a year before he introduced her to me.

And I’ll never forget what he whispered as we walked back to the car after that first dinner.

“She doesn’t lie. That’s all I really care about now.”

I smiled, but it hurt a little too—how low the bar had become.

Still, I understood.

Ryan proposed to Lira a year later. And this time, I was the first person he told. Not just invited—he asked me to help plan the engagement.

The wedding was small and sweet. No drama. No fake paternity tests. Just laughter, real vows, and a lot of dancing.

A few months after their honeymoon, Ryan got a job offer across the state. They moved into a townhouse and started talking about having kids “eventually, not urgently.”

He’s cautious now. More guarded, but wiser too. I see it in the way he listens before reacting, how he doesn’t get swept up in things easily anymore.

Sometimes life teaches the hardest lessons through the people we love most. And sometimes, the people who hurt us leave behind wisdom we never expected to gain.

As for Shelley, I heard through Jen that she and her ex didn’t work out. He stopped showing up after a year, and she’s raising her son on her own now.

I don’t feel satisfaction from that.

But I do feel peace.

And I feel grateful—for the gut instinct that told me something was off, and for the courage it took to speak up when it mattered most.

Because standing up for the truth, even when it costs you everything, is what makes love real.

Ryan found his way. And I’m finally back in his life, not just as a parent—but as someone he trusts again.

Sometimes, doing the right thing doesn’t make you popular. But it does keep your integrity intact. And in the end, that’s what people remember.

If this story resonated with you, please share it with someone who might need to hear it today.

❤️ Like and share if you’ve ever had to stand up for someone you love, even when it was hard.